I captured two more swarms yesterday one lareg and one rather small.  THe large one I hived already, but the smaller swarm i captured right at dusk and havent hived yet.... can I combine them with the other swarm in the hive using the newspaper technique?  any suggestions?  I can do another hive but this swarm is small.  THanks for all the help and great info on this site!

The newspaper technique works great for combining swarms. Make sure both have an entrance until they're combined, probably a day or two.

I wouldn't personally. If the only reason is they are small, then put in nuc and feed, fed ,feed. They will produce comb like crazy b/c they are swarm. plenty of time to get them winter ready. I only combine if they would otherwise fail.
